Как задать в запрос SQL значение из переменной с помощью кубиков?

Tony Soprano

Новичок
Регистрация
07.11.2018
Сообщения
29
Благодарностей
7
Баллы
3
Нашол пост, которыя по сути отвечает на мой вопрос. Только вот я не настолько знаком с функционалом чтоб понять и осуществить то что в этом посте описанно. Возможно ли сделать тоже самое только с помощью кубиков?
Прикрепил то что смог сделать я. В ProjectMaker всё отображаеться так, как если делать всё мануально руками, но после нажатия в ProjectMaker на кнопку выполнения SQL запроса, происходит только выполнение команды (SELECT * FROM `wp_posts` WHERE 1), которая стоит по умолчанию в окне, где вставляються SQL запросы.
 

Вложения

  • 85,8 КБ Просмотры: 130

AleXPrischepA

Client
Регистрация
06.05.2015
Сообщения
209
Благодарностей
97
Баллы
28
Нашол пост, которыя по сути отвечает на мой вопрос. Только вот я не настолько знаком с функционалом чтоб понять и осуществить то что в этом посте описанно. Возможно ли сделать тоже самое только с помощью кубиков?
Прикрепил то что смог сделать я. В ProjectMaker всё отображаеться так, как если делать всё мануально руками, но после нажатия в ProjectMaker на кнопку выполнения SQL запроса, происходит только выполнение команды (SELECT * FROM `wp_posts` WHERE 1), которая стоит по умолчанию в окне, где вставляються SQL запросы.
http://2sql.ru/basic/sql-update/ очень коротко и очень понятно, с примерами и пояснениями.
 

Tony Soprano

Новичок
Регистрация
07.11.2018
Сообщения
29
Благодарностей
7
Баллы
3
Спасибо за ссылку. Но сами SQL запросы я составил. И они работают. Проблема не в этом. Прочитайте более внимательно первый пост.
 

AleXPrischepA

Client
Регистрация
06.05.2015
Сообщения
209
Благодарностей
97
Баллы
28
Спасибо за ссылку. Но сами SQL запросы я составил. И они работают. Проблема не в этом. Прочитайте более внимательно первый пост.
Шаблон не могу открыть. Нет пк под рукой. Завтра если не забуду гляну.
 
  • Спасибо
Реакции: Tony Soprano

AleXPrischepA

Client
Регистрация
06.05.2015
Сообщения
209
Благодарностей
97
Баллы
28
И еще... 1 кубик = 1 запрос. В одном кубике 2 и более запроса к бд работать не будут.
 

Tony Soprano

Новичок
Регистрация
07.11.2018
Сообщения
29
Благодарностей
7
Баллы
3
У меня так всё и выстроенно. Всё по шагово. Действие за действием. В принцыпе простая по сути задача. Строку с SQL запросом вставить в нужное для этого окно и жать кнопку для выполнения этого запроса и так по кругу. Вопрос только в одном, почему невставляеться по факту вставленный SQL запрос? В ProjectMaker во время тестирования я визуально вижу что всё вставляеться как нужно. Но после нажатия на кнопку выполнения SQL запроса, происходит только выполнение команды (SELECT * FROM `wp_posts` WHERE 1), которая стоит по умолчанию в окне, где вставляються SQL запросы. Как я уже описывал выше.
 

AleXPrischepA

Client
Регистрация
06.05.2015
Сообщения
209
Благодарностей
97
Баллы
28
(SELECT * FROM `wp_posts` WHERE 1), которая стоит по умолчанию в окне, где вставляються SQL запросы.
Что значит стоит по умолчанию в поле запроса? Оно по умолчанию пустое должно быть. Скинь скрин экшена.
 

Koqpe

Client
Регистрация
23.12.2014
Сообщения
1 100
Благодарностей
649
Баллы
113
Только вот я не настолько знаком с функционалом чтоб понять и простить
Так наверно логичнее познакомится с функционалом, а не тыкать пальцем в небо.
Качайте первый курс и изучайте https://zennolab.com/wiki/ru:zennoposter_start , ну или
Вы в своем шаблоне зажигалкой греете трехтонную болванку для ковки...
 
  • Спасибо
Реакции: Tony Soprano

Tony Soprano

Новичок
Регистрация
07.11.2018
Сообщения
29
Благодарностей
7
Баллы
3
У меня стоит по умолчанию в окне запрос, я так понимаю это простой пример постройки SQL запроса. Но даже если я принудительно очищаю это окно и потом вставляю в него свой запрос, то всёравно происходит только действие по запросу который стоял в окне по умолчанию.
Hет смысла кидать тут скрины. Я прикрепил файл проекта. Если у кого то есть время и желание помочь. То откройте файл через ProjectMaker, там всё видно что и как я делал.
 

Tony Soprano

Новичок
Регистрация
07.11.2018
Сообщения
29
Благодарностей
7
Баллы
3
Так наверно логичнее познакомится с функционалом, а не тыкать пальцем в небо.
Качайте первый курс и изучайте https://zennolab.com/wiki/ru:zennoposter_start
Вы в своем шаблоне зажигалкой греете трехтонную болванку для ковки...
Для этой простой по сути задачи не вижу смысла бросать всё и изучать постоение кода C#
Может кто то из админов сказать почему визуально происходит вставка текстовой строки с SQL запросом в окно, а по факту после нажатия на кнопку для выполнения действия, происходит совсем не то.

Пример работы проекта в ProjectMaker :
По умолчанию у меня в окне стоит: SELECT * FROM `wp_posts` WHERE 1
1. Очищаю это окно кнопкой "Clear"
2. Вставляю 100% рабочий SQL запрос: update wp_posts set post_content = replace(post_content, 'xxxxxx', 'xxxxxx') WHERE 1;
3. Жму кнопу "ок"
4. Получаю ответ что по данному запросу "SELECT * FROM `wp_posts` WHERE 1" ничего невыполненно


Все эти действия так же опробованны мной мануально на своём PC. Всё работает.
 
Последнее редактирование:

AleXPrischepA

Client
Регистрация
06.05.2015
Сообщения
209
Благодарностей
97
Баллы
28

Tony Soprano

Новичок
Регистрация
07.11.2018
Сообщения
29
Благодарностей
7
Баллы
3
В экшене есть такая кнопка? Друже... может я что не понял... НО ИНТРИГУ ТЫ СОЗДАЛ. ЗАВТРА ОБЯЗАТЕЛЬНО ГЛЯНУ ЧТО ТАМ ЗА ЗВЕРЯ ТЫ СОБРАЛ.
Все действия, которые я описал выше производяться экшенами. Я просто привёл пример в какой последовательности они осуществляются.
 

AleXPrischepA

Client
Регистрация
06.05.2015
Сообщения
209
Благодарностей
97
Баллы
28
Все действия, которые я описал выше производяться экшенами. Я просто привёл пример в какой последовательности они осуществляются.
СТОЯМБА!!! Ты сейчас хочешь сказать, что работаешь с БД сайта, через веб морду, вместо того чтоб работать с базой напрямую через ЭКШЕН БД. Я НЕ ПРО C#... Я про экшен БД... Верно?
 
  • Спасибо
Реакции: Koqpe

Tony Soprano

Новичок
Регистрация
07.11.2018
Сообщения
29
Благодарностей
7
Баллы
3

AleXPrischepA

Client
Регистрация
06.05.2015
Сообщения
209
Благодарностей
97
Баллы
28

Burklive

Client
Регистрация
10.05.2017
Сообщения
123
Благодарностей
33
Баллы
28
так вроде бы есть кубик для работы с бд

48122
 
  • Спасибо
Реакции: Tony Soprano и Koqpe

Koqpe

Client
Регистрация
23.12.2014
Сообщения
1 100
Благодарностей
649
Баллы
113
Для этой простой по сути задачи не вижу смысла бросать всё и изучать постоение кода C#
Какой еще C#? Первый курс про интерфейс, про кубики.
Изучите основы, КУБИКИ и действия с ними, без этого действительно нет смысла, так и будите работать через пятую точку.
Хотя бы видео под спойлером посмотрели в моем предыдущем сообщении?

История этого топика:
Смотрю у новичка проблема с запросом к базе данных через кубик, да еще и шаблон приложен, думаю надо помочь товарищу по быстрому, скачиваю шаблон,
открываю, 16 кубиков в шаблоне и ни одного кубика по работе с базой данный:
:-)
 
Последнее редактирование:
  • Спасибо
Реакции: Burklive

Tony Soprano

Новичок
Регистрация
07.11.2018
Сообщения
29
Благодарностей
7
Баллы
3
Я понял. Настрю кубик для работы с базой данных и буду работать с ним. Всём спасиб!
 

Tony Soprano

Новичок
Регистрация
07.11.2018
Сообщения
29
Благодарностей
7
Баллы
3
Какая же удобная штука этот кубик для работы с базой данных. А я вчера парился пол дня огороды строил.
 
  • Спасибо
Реакции: Koqpe

AleXPrischepA

Client
Регистрация
06.05.2015
Сообщения
209
Благодарностей
97
Баллы
28
Какая же удобная штука этот кубик для работы с базой данных. А я вчера парился пол дня огороды строил
Вы просто батенька знаете толк в "ИЗВРАЩЕНИЯХ"))) :ay::ay: Хорошей работы)
 
  • Спасибо
Реакции: Tony Soprano и Koqpe

Tony Soprano

Новичок
Регистрация
07.11.2018
Сообщения
29
Благодарностей
7
Баллы
3
Вопрос не по теме, но может быть кто небудь может подсказать решение.
Мне нужно заменить на своём блоге, в тексте всех постов, знак ' на html код '
Как это можно реализовать? Проблема в том что в SQL запросе уже присутствует знак '
Вот пример:

update wp_posts set post_content = replace(post_content, ''', ''') WHERE 1;


Если на форуме есть подходящая для моего вопроса ветка, по пожалуйста перенестите мой пост туда.
 
Последнее редактирование:

Koqpe

Client
Регистрация
23.12.2014
Сообщения
1 100
Благодарностей
649
Баллы
113
Мне нужно заменить на своём блоге, в тексте всех постов, знак ' на html код '
Кубик обработка текста - замена.
Так и будем по одному кубику перебирать?
Качайте первый курс и изучайте https://zennolab.com/wiki/ru:zennoposter_start
Там делов то на пару часов...
Еще поиск по форуму помогает.
 
Последнее редактирование:

Tony Soprano

Новичок
Регистрация
07.11.2018
Сообщения
29
Благодарностей
7
Баллы
3
На блоге 20к постов. Мне надо во всех этих постах знак ' на html код ' Как мне поможет "Кубик обработка текста - замена"? Если не трудно. Приведите пожалуйста пример. Я знаком с этим кубиком и если использовать его, я могу себе только приставить такое действие. Заходить в каждый пост и редактировать текст с помощью этого кубика. Я же хотел заменить этот знак ' во всех моих постах с помощью SQL запроса.
 

AleXPrischepA

Client
Регистрация
06.05.2015
Сообщения
209
Благодарностей
97
Баллы
28
Друже... я тебе ссылку на SQL давал!? Ты что ответил...

Спасибо за ссылку. Но сами SQL запросы я составил. И они работают. Проблема не в этом.
Тут помогите... и вопрос по SQL...
Не получается составить запрос..

update wp_posts set post_content = replace(post_content, ''', ''') WHERE 1;
Конкретно в этом случае использование " (двойных) может помочь. Насколько это правильно НЕ знаю. Но работать должно, по крайней мере у меня работало.

SQL:
update wp_posts set post_content = replace(post_content, "'", "'") WHERE 1;
А вообще человек дело говорит.
просмотри курс, и потом когда начнёшь писать, уж в голове будет всплывать, как делали люди...
 

Tony Soprano

Новичок
Регистрация
07.11.2018
Сообщения
29
Благодарностей
7
Баллы
3

Кто просматривает тему: (Всего: 3, Пользователи: 0, Гости: 3)